Candle Flame Interpretation

Candle flame interprets a lot of messages about your spell work. It's very important especially for beginners to pay close attention to the candle flame while casting a spell. Any questions related to this article are welcome.

A Strong Flame: This indicates that power and energy are going into your desire for manifestation. When a figure candle is used, a strong flame generally means that the person represented is winning, angry, or using authority over another. When two figure candles are present, the higher and stronger flame represents authority over the other.

A Weak Flame: This can show that you are facing heavy opposition and must redo the magick several times to overcome the power you are facing. The weak flame can also indicate, on a figure candle, that the subject is losing the battle. The weak flame that goes out means that you've missed your target altogether, start over.

A Jumping Flame: This is an attention getter. It can indicate raw emotions along with explosions of energy.

Rainbow Flame: If your flame is composed of various colors this indicates that there are outside influences at work that may be beyond the power of the questioner. Colors can also show that the question may be best answered at a later date. The factors involved may need a change to develop and evolve for a clearer view of what may occur.

Direction of Flame Movement

  • North: On a waxing moon, something physical is manifesting.
  • East: Something mental is manifesting.
  • South: In love matters, you can expect a steamy love affair that doesn't last too long.
  • West: Emotional aspects. A good sign of success and love.

Direction of Smoke

  • Northern Movement: Something physical is manifesting. You will have to work for what you wish to achieve.
  • Eastern Movement: Something mental is manifesting. Think things through and have patience.
  • Southern Movement: Something intense and short lived is manifesting. Success comes rapidly and with intensity.
  • Western Movement: The manifestation of strong Magick intervention. The issue is too emotional. You are too involved. Step away for a time. Clear your thoughts.

Infrequent Noise (Soft) : Pure thoughts, intimate conversation.

Frequent Noise (Mild): An authority figure giving orders or directions.

Frequent Chatter (Strong): Arguments, quarrels or loud disagreements.
